Which chemical formula shows an ionic compound?

Responses

NaCl

C6H12O6

N2O

CO2

ionic compounds are those compounds which are held by ionic bonds which are formed by the charged cations are anions .

Here, out of the four options, Nacl is an ionic compound as na+ is a cation and cl- is an anion.
